Ticket: Pop-up office setup — Meridale Expo Hall

Hi reception folks! We're running a temporary Fennelworth Software booth-office at the Larkspur Trade Fair next week, and you're the friendly faces staffing the front table. Deliveries of banners and demo kits arrive Tuesday morning — sign for anything addressed to the Fennelworth pop-up. The back storage cabin is where the laptops live overnight, so keep it locked whenever you step away. To get into the cabin, use the following pass code:

staff pass of kagup-fajog = bdg-QCHVQW-99665837

TURN-208: Gatevale turnstile counters at the Merrow Field pilot double-count when a rotation reverses mid-cycle. Attendance totals drift roughly 2% high per event. The debounce window fix is implemented, reviewed by Ilsa, and soak-tested across two simulated match days without drift. Ready for your cut; the candidate build is identified below.

trace token, tagag-tafog: htk6_5ed18c

Hey plugin folks — quick orientation on how crashes flow. Your plugin's crash payloads land in the Fennelcast collector, get symbolicated, then batch-forward to the triage board roughly every few minutes. If your symbols aren't uploaded before the batch window closes, the report still lands, just unreadable, so upload early. Oversized payloads get truncated, not dropped, and you'll see a truncation flag in the metadata. The collector's batching, size limits, and symbolication timeouts are all governed by the settings below.

settings of fafog-haduf:
ZORIX_PIN=4648
ZORIX_METRICS_HOST=metrics.zorix.paliqsys.corp
ZORIX_LOG_LEVEL=info
ZORIX_TENANT=druix

## Changelog — Clockmire v1.9

Defaults updated following the cron drift investigation. We found that jobs scheduled near the top of the hour drifted up to 40 seconds because the tick loop slept a full interval before checking the queue. The default tick interval is now 5 seconds, and drift correction is enabled by default.

Reviewers: the behavioral change is confined to the scheduler loop; job definitions are untouched. The new default configuration shipped with this release follows below.

deployment values, yadug-bawif:
[framir]
team = pelox
access_code = ac_a38ab2
owner = tamion.julael
host = framir.tolvaqlabs.test
port = 11211
peer = tammir.zemvargrid.local
salt = 2215ef03
pin = 1541